    De Oude Aarde is a quaint Museum that displays minerals, fossils, and some of the most beautiful gems that have been collected since the year 1969. René Boissevain, the founder of the Museum had been on several voyages and discovered great things which is what has made the collection so unique.     De Weerribben-Wieden National Park, just as the name suggests is a National Park which comprises of north-western Europe’s largest bog. The unique landscape of water plains, swamp forests, reed beds and canals attract a lot of people from far and wide to come and experience its beauty themselves.
